Output 9464063f9ef5dc127e568d45c828f9045a3eb3af825861aeee829fd0b2588b55:1

value
73665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b6fbcafa10546056842f8976d307ac65b20ce8 OP_EQUAL
address
3QdxjcaZFTGRW7K8AqejyU6mQxSpTf5o6D
transaction
9464063f9ef5dc127e568d45c828f9045a3eb3af825861aeee829fd0b2588b55
confirmations
179200
spent
true